WebOn January 11, 2010, DMH issued an RFP to provide CalWORKs mental health supportive services. The issuance of the RFP was in accordance with State requirements regarding the allocation of CalWORKs funding within Los Angeles County. The RFP was distributed to agencies on the Departmental Bidders list which included minority agencies. WebFeb 11, 2024 · Budget Overview. Total CalWORKs Spending Projected to Increase Alongside Growing Caseload. As shown in Figure 2, the Governor’s budget proposes $6.9 billion in total funding for the CalWORKs program in 2024‑23, a net increase of $291 million (4 percent) relative to the most recent estimate of current‑year spending. This budget adjustment is a result of the Adopted FY 2002-2003 State Budget, which allocated $24.9 million to the County’s CalWORKs Mental Health Program. This allocation represents a net increase of $4.9 million to DMH’s existing Board adopted budget of $20
